Use of 2’,3’,5’-Tri-O-benzoyl-5-difluoromethyluridine2’,3’,5’-Tri-O-benzoyl-5-difluoromethyluridine is a thymidine analog. Analogs of this series have insertional activity towards replicated DNA. They can be used to label cells and track DNA synthesis[1]. |
